--Study Reveals How the Tipping Landscape Has Evolved-- WHITING, Ind., April 4,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- Is conventional tipping a thing of the past? A new survey from CouponCabin.com reveals that many consumers make their own rules when it comes to leaving a gratuity. In fact, more than one-quarter (26 percent) of U.S. adults who tip and use coupons or daily deals tip on the discounted total, resulting in a lower payday for those performing the services. redOrbit Staff & Wire Reports - Your Universe Online Waitresses wearing red get bigger tips from men, according to a new study published in Journal of Hospitality and Tourism Research (published by SAGE, on behalf of the International Council on Hotel, Restaurant, and Institutional Education). Tips received from customers is what wait staff working at restaurants throughout the world depend on. Researchers Nicolas Guéguen and Céline Jacob studied 272 restaurant customers and found...
